Josef Albers : Homage to the Square 1950-1976€73.99
Josef Albers' groundbreaking series Homage to the Square comprises roughly two thousand oil paintings. His continuous reflections and refinements for more than 25 years inspired numerous young minimal and conceptual artists in their search for a reduced formal language.

HR Giger. 40th Ed.€29.99
Swiss artist HR Giger (1940, 2014) is most famous for his creation of the space monster in Ridley Scott's 1979 horror sci-fi film Alien, which earned him an Oscar.
